About Roisan
Roisan: Alpine Village in the Heart of Valle d'Aosta
Roisan is a small comune in the Aosta Valley, northwestern Italy, sitting at roughly 900 metres above sea level on the hills south of Aosta city, approximately 8 km from the regional capital. The village overlooks the main valley floor and offers direct views toward the Gran Paradiso massif to the south. Medieval stone hamlets — known locally as borgate — dot the municipal territory, preserving the characteristic dry-stone architecture of the western Alps.
Where to Stay and Getting Around
Visitors come to Roisan primarily as a base for hiking the surrounding ridgelines or cycling the valley roads linking Nus and Saint-Christophe. The A5 motorway (Turin–Mont Blanc) passes through the valley below, making Roisan reachable within roughly 2 hours from Turin. Aosta railway station, served by regional trains from Turin Porta Nuova, is the nearest rail hub.
Practical Tips
- Getting there: Regional trains reach Aosta; Roisan lies 8 km south by road.
- Best season: June–September for hiking; December–March for nearby ski areas.
- Local language: French and Franco-Provençal are co-official alongside Italian in Valle d'Aosta.
- Pack layers: Evening temperatures drop sharply even in summer at altitude.
